AI绘图结果,仅供参考
在构建高性能Linux环境时,选择合适的操作系统版本是关键。推荐使用长期支持(LTS)的发行版,如Ubuntu 20.04或CentOS Stream,这些版本提供了稳定的内核和软件包更新,有助于减少系统不稳定的风险。
硬件配置直接影响性能表现。建议使用SSD作为系统盘以提高I/O速度,同时确保足够的内存和多核CPU,这对于运行复杂的机器学习模型尤为重要。•配置适当的网络带宽可以加快数据传输效率。
软件优化同样不可忽视。安装必要的开发工具链,如GCC、Python和CUDA(如果使用GPU),并根据需求调整内核参数,例如增加文件描述符限制和调整调度策略,可以显著提升系统性能。
在机器学习优化方面,合理选择算法和框架是核心。TensorFlow和PyTorch等主流框架支持分布式训练,结合Kubernetes或Docker可以实现高效的资源管理与任务调度。
数据预处理和特征工程对模型效果有决定性影响。使用Pandas和NumPy进行数据清洗,配合Scikit-learn进行特征选择,能够有效提升模型训练效率和预测准确性。
•持续监控系统资源使用情况,利用Prometheus和Grafana等工具进行性能分析,有助于及时发现瓶颈并进行针对性优化。